Как отключить подсветку кнопок на Xiaomi: пошаговое руководство для всех моделей

Подсветка сенсорных или физических кнопок на смартфонах Xiaomi — полезная функция для использования в темноте, но далеко не всем пользователям она нравится. Кто-то считает её отвлекающей, кто-то — слишком яркой, а некоторые просто хотят сэкономить заряд батареи. К сожалению, в стандартных настройках MIUI опция отключения подсветки часто скрыта или отсутствует вовсе — особенно на бюджетных моделях Redmi и POCO.

В этой статье мы разберём 5 рабочих способов отключить подсветку кнопок на любом устройстве Xiaomi — от простых настроек в меню до использования ADB и сторонних приложений. Все методы протестированы на прошивках MIUI 12–15 и актуальны для моделей 2020–2026 годов. Если вы устали от назойливого свечения кнопок «Назад», «Домой» или «Недавние», следуйте инструкциям ниже.

Прежде чем приступать, учтите: некоторые способы требуют прав разработчика или подключения к ПК. Если вы новичок — начните с первых двух методов, они самые безопасные. Для опытных пользователей мы подготовили расширенные варианты с ADB и модификацией системных файлов.

1. Отключение подсветки через стандартные настройки MIUI

На некоторых моделях Xiaomi (например, Redmi Note 10 Pro, POCO X3 Pro) опция отключения подсветки кнопок спрятана в меню «Экран» или «Дополнительные настройки». Проверьте её наличие по этому пути:

  1. Откройте Настройки → Экран.
  2. Прокрутите вниз и найдите раздел «Подсветка кнопок» (или Button backlight на английской прошивке).
  3. Переключите ползунок в положение «Выкл.» или выберите Always off.

Если такого пункта нет — не расстраивайтесь. На большинстве устройств (например, Redmi 9A, POCO M3) эта опция отсутствует в базовой конфигурации. В таком случае переходите к следующему способу.

⚠️ Внимание: На прошивках MIUI 14+ для европейского региона (EEA) пункт с подсветкой кнопок может называться Ambient display & lock screen → Button lights. Если не находите — используйте поиск по настройкам (значок лупы в правом верхнем углу).
📊 Какая модель Xiaomi у вас?
Redmi Note 10/11/12
POCO X3/X4/X5
Redmi 9/10/13
Mi 11/12/13
Другая модель

2. Использование режима «Без звука» (для сенсорных кнопок)

Малоизвестный лайфхак: на некоторых устройствах Xiaomi подсветка сенсорных кнопок (например, на Redmi 8A или POCO C31) автоматически отключается при активации режима «Без звука» (не путать с «Вибрацией»!). Этот метод работает не на всех моделях, но попробовать стоит:

  • 🔕 Активируйте режим «Без звука» через панель уведомлений (свайп вниз → иконка колокольчика с перечёркнутым динамиком).
  • 📱 Проверьте, погасла ли подсветка кнопок. Если да — проблема решена.
  • 🔄 Если нет — верните звук обратно и переходите к другим способам.

Этот метод не влияет на физические кнопки (например, на Redmi Note 8 Pro), но часто срабатывает на устройствах с сенсорной панелью навигации. Главный минус — вам придётся постоянно держать телефон в беззвучном режиме, что не всегда удобно.

3. Отключение подсветки через ADB (универсальный метод)

Если стандартные настройки не помогли, самый надёжный способ — использовать ADB-команды. Этот метод работает на 90% устройств Xiaomi, включая Redmi, POCO и Mi, но требует подключения к компьютеру. Вот пошаговая инструкция:

Установите драйверы Xiaomi на ПК|Включите отладку по USB в настройках телефона|Скачайте платформу ADB с официального сайта Google|Подключите телефон к ПК оригинальным кабелем-->

Шаг 1. Включите отладку по USB:

  1. Перейдите в Настройки → О телефоне.
  2. Нажмите 7 раз на Версия MIUI, пока не появится уведомление «Вы стали разработчиком!».
  3. Вернитесь в Настройки → Дополнительные настройки → Для разработчиков.
  4. Активируйте Отладка по USB и подтвердите разрешение.

Шаг 2. Подключите телефон к ПК и выполните команду:

adb shell settings put system button_backlight 0

Шаг 3. Перезагрузите устройство. Подсветка кнопок должна исчезнуть. Чтобы вернуть её обратно, используйте:

adb shell settings put system button_backlight 1
⚠️ Внимание: На некоторых прошивках (например, MIUI 13 для POCO F3) команда может не сработать с первого раза. В таком случае попробуйте альтернативный вариант:
adb shell settings put secure button_backlight 0

Если и это не поможет — переходите к способу с MIUI Tweaks.

Что делать, если ADB не распознаёт устройство?

1. Проверьте, установлены ли драйверы Xiaomi USB Drivers (скачать можно на официальном сайте).

2. Попробуйте другой USB-кабель (лучше оригинальный).

3. Включите в настройках разработчика опцию Отладка по USB (безопасный режим).

4. Перезагрузите ПК и телефон, затем повторите подключение.

4. Приложение MIUI Tweaks (для продвинутых пользователей)

Если ADB кажется слишком сложным, можно воспользоваться сторонним приложением MIUI Tweaks. Оно позволяет управлять скрытыми настройками MIUI, включая подсветку кнопок. Учтите: приложение требует root-прав или активированной отладки по USB.

Инструкция:

  1. Скачайте MIUI Tweaks с форума XDA (доступно бесплатно).
  2. Установите APK-файл и откройте приложение.
  3. Перейдите в раздел Display → Button backlight.
  4. Выберите «Disable» и сохраните изменения.
  5. Перезагрузите устройство.

Преимущество этого метода — не нужно вручную вводить ADB-команды. Однако будьте осторожны: неправильные настройки в MIUI Tweaks могут привести к сбоям в работе интерфейса. Рекомендуем создать бэкап перед внесением изменений.

Метод Требуется ПК Требуются root-права Сложность Работает на MIUI 14+
Стандартные настройки ❌ Нет ❌ Нет ⭐ Очень просто ✅ Да (не на всех)
Режим «Без звука» ❌ Нет ❌ Нет ⭐ Очень просто ✅ Да (частично)
ADB-команды ✅ Да ❌ Нет ⭐⭐ Средняя ✅ Да
MIUI Tweaks ❌ Нет ⚠️ Желательны ⭐⭐⭐ Сложно ✅ Да

5. Ручное редактирование системных файлов (для опытных)

Этот способ подходит только для пользователей с root-правами и знанием структуры Android. Неправильные действия могут привести к «брику» устройства!

Подсветка кнопок управляется системным файлом /system/usr/keylayout/Generic.kl или /vendor/usr/keylayout/*.kl. Чтобы отключить её, нужно изменить параметр keylights:

  1. Получите root-доступ (например, через Magisk).
  2. Используйте Root Explorer или ADB Shell с правами суперпользователя.
  3. Найдите файл Generic.kl и откройте его в текстовом редакторе.
  4. Найдите строку с keylights и замените значение на 0.
  5. Сохраните изменения, установите права 644 и перезагрузите устройство.

Пример строки до и после редактирования:

# До:

key 158 BACK WAKE_DROPPED keylights=1

После:

key 158 BACK WAKE_DROPPED keylights=0

⚠️ Внимание: На некоторых устройствах (например, POCO X3 NFC) файл может называться иначе — qwerty.kl или mtk-kpd.kl. Перед редактированием сделайте резервную копию файла! Также учтите, что после обновления MIUI изменения могут сброситься.

6. Альтернативные решения: наклейки, чехлы, настройки энергосбережения

Если программные методы не сработали или вы не хотите рисковать, есть несколько физических способов скрыть подсветку:

  • 📱 Используйте чехол с высокими бортиками — он закроет светодиоды кнопок.
  • 🎨 Наклейте на кнопки матовую плёнку или изоленту (аккуратно, чтобы не мешать нажатиям).
  • 🔋 Включите режим сверхэкономии (Настройки → Батарея → Режим сверхэкономии) — он отключает часть подсветок.
  • 🌙 Установите тёмную тему и уменьшите яркость экрана — это снизит заметность подсветки.

Эти методы не уберут подсветку полностью, но сделают её менее раздражающей. Например, на Redmi 9T многие пользователи просто заклеивают кнопки чёрным скотчем — дёшево и сердито.

FAQ: Частые вопросы о подсветке кнопок на Xiaomi

❓ Почему на моём Xiaomi нет опции отключения подсветки в настройках?

Производитель убрал эту функцию из меню на бюджетных моделях (например, Redmi 9A, POCO C3) для упрощения интерфейса. В таком случае используйте ADB или MIUI Tweaks.

❓ Подсветка кнопок сама включается ночью. Как это исправить?

Скорее всего, у вас активирован режим «Подсветка при уведомлениях». Отключите его в Настройки → Экран → Подсветка при уведомлениях (или Ambient Display).

❓ Будут ли работать эти методы на POCO F5 или Redmi Note 12?

Да, все способы (кроме редактирования системных файлов) совместимы с последними моделями на MIUI 14. Для POCO F5 лучше использовать ADB, так как в настройках опция отсутствует.

❓ Можно ли отключить подсветку только для одной кнопки (например, «Назад»)?

К сожалению, нет. Все методы отключают подсветку всех кнопок одновременно. Частичное отключение возможно только через редактирование keylayout-файлов (способ 5), но это рискованно.

❓ После отключения подсветки кнопки перестали светиться даже при зарядке. Это нормально?

Да, некоторые устройства (например, Redmi Note 11) используют те же светодиоды для индикации зарядки. Если это критично — верните подсветку обратно или используйте чехол с LED-индикатором.